A285574 Irregular triangle read by rows which arises from a diagram which is similar to the diagram of A261699, but here the even-indexed zig-zag lines are located on the right-hand side of the vertical axis of the diagram. 3
1, 1, 1, 3, 1, 0, 1, 5, 1, 3, 0, 1, 0, 7, 1, 0, 0, 1, 3, 9, 1, 0, 5, 0, 1, 0, 0, 11, 1, 3, 0, 0, 1, 0, 0, 13, 1, 0, 7, 0, 1, 3, 5, 0, 15, 1, 0, 0, 0, 0, 1, 0, 0, 0, 17, 1, 3, 0, 9, 0, 1, 0, 0, 0, 19, 1, 0, 5, 0, 0, 1, 3, 0, 7, 0, 21, 1, 0, 0, 0, 11, 0, 1, 0, 0, 0, 0, 23, 1, 3, 0, 0, 0, 0, 1, 0, 5, 0, 0, 25 (list; graph; refs; listen; history; text; internal format)
OFFSET
1,4
COMMENTS
In the diagram we have that:
The number of horizontal line segments in the n-th row of the structure equals A001227(n), the number of partitions of n into consecutive parts.
The number of horizontal line segments in the left-hand part of the n-th row equals A082647, the number of partitions of n into an odd number of consecutive parts.
The number of horizontal line segments in the right-hand part of the n-th row equals A131576, the number of partitions of n into an even number of consecutive parts.
The diagram explains the unusual ordering of the terms in the triangle A261699, in which the even-indexed zig-zag lines are located on the left-hand side of the vertical axis of the diagram.

CROSSREFS
Positive terms give A182469.
Row n has length A003056(n).
The sum of row n is A000593(n).
Column k starts in row A000217(k).
The number of positive terms in row n is A001227(n).
